New shop to open in Midhurst

A new gift shop is set to open its doors in Midhurst.

Blown Away, owned by Jackie and Ian Dummer, will open at 10am on Saturday in the North Street site previously used as a post office/tuck shop.

Jackie said: “It’s a new venture. The shop has been empty since May but we thought we’d wait until Christmas before doing something with it.

"[On Saturday], we will have things on for the kids, including face painting and party bags.”

The shop’s Facebook page said it will provide balloons and gifts for ‘every party and occasion’.
